ISLAMABAD: Pakistan Electronic Media Regulatory Authority (PEMRA), in its meeting on Wednesday, approved the suspension of both Licences of BOL TV – BOL News and BOL Entertainment – till the fulfillment of all legal and codal formalities.
The decision was taken during the 106th meeting of PEMRA. Four newly notified members from provinces also attended their maiden meeting. Executive member/acting PEMRA chairman, in his welcome note to the new members, expressed hope that they would work towards greater understanding of the electronic media laws and the authority would benefit from the wealth of their experience and their contribution would help to make organisation more strong and robust in discharging its regulatory functions.
